Young British muslims : identity, culture, politics and the media /

Based on 216 in-depth interviews of Muslims in Britain, examines how British Muslim youths and young adults, 15-30 years old, define their identities, their values and their culture and whether these conflict either with those of their parents or with the dominant non-Muslim British culture.
